哈希游戏机器人开发,从技术到应用的探索哈希游戏机器人开发

哈希游戏机器人开发,从技术到应用的探索哈希游戏机器人开发,

本文目录导读:

  1. 哈希游戏机器人开发的技术背景
  2. 哈希游戏机器人开发的开发流程
  3. 哈希游戏机器人开发的应用场景
  4. 哈希游戏机器人开发的未来趋势

哈希游戏机器人开发的技术背景

哈希游戏机器人开发的核心在于将哈希算法与机器人控制相结合,以实现高效的机器人行为模拟和游戏场景构建,哈希算法作为一种快速查找表数据结构,其核心优势在于能够在常数时间内完成数据的查找、插入和删除操作,这种特性使其在机器人路径规划、行为决策和数据处理等方面具有显著优势。

  1. 哈希算法的优势
    哈希算法通过将输入数据映射到固定大小的表中,可以显著提高数据处理的速度,在机器人开发中,哈希表可以用于快速定位传感器数据、游戏场景中的目标位置,以及机器人自身的运动状态,这种快速响应能力使得机器人在复杂的游戏环境中也能保持高效运行。

  2. 机器人开发的需求
    随着游戏的复杂性增加,机器人需要具备更强的自主决策能力,哈希游戏机器人开发通过利用哈希算法,能够快速构建机器人行为模型,从而实现更智能的机器人控制,在竞技游戏中,机器人可以根据当前游戏状态快速做出移动、攻击或防御的决策。

  3. 游戏开发的挑战
    游戏开发中,机器人需要与人类玩家或其他机器人进行交互,这种交互需要实时响应,同时保证游戏的公平性和趣味性,哈希游戏机器人开发通过优化数据处理效率,能够为游戏交互提供更流畅的体验。


哈希游戏机器人开发的开发流程

哈希游戏机器人开发的流程大致可以分为以下几个阶段:需求分析、算法设计、系统实现、测试优化和部署,每个阶段都需要结合哈希算法的特点,进行针对性的设计和优化。

  1. 需求分析
    在开发之前,需要明确机器人在游戏中的具体功能和应用场景,机器人是否需要在竞技场中进行导航,或者是否需要在特定场景中执行特定动作,通过明确需求,可以为后续的算法设计和系统实现提供方向。

  2. 算法设计
    哈希算法的设计是整个开发过程的关键,需要根据机器人在游戏中的具体需求,选择合适的哈希结构和哈希函数,使用哈希表来存储机器人可能的移动路径,或者使用哈希树来优化机器人行为决策的层次结构。

  3. 系统实现
    在算法设计的基础上,需要将哈希算法转化为具体的代码实现,这包括机器人传感器的集成、哈希表的构建、行为决策的实现以及与游戏引擎的接口设计,通过代码实现,机器人可以在实际游戏中展现出预期的功能。

  4. 测试优化
    测试是机器人开发中不可或缺的环节,通过不断测试机器人在不同游戏场景中的表现,可以发现并解决代码中的问题,优化哈希算法的性能,可以进一步提升机器人的运行效率。

  5. 部署
    将开发好的机器人部署到实际游戏环境中,通过与游戏引擎的集成,机器人可以在真实的游戏场景中运行,可以利用哈希算法的高效性,确保机器人在运行过程中保持流畅。


哈希游戏机器人开发的应用场景

哈希游戏机器人开发的应用场景非常广泛,涵盖了多个游戏类型和机器人功能,以下是几种典型的应用场景:

  1. 竞技游戏机器人
    在竞技游戏中,机器人需要具备快速的决策能力和高效的运行效率,通过哈希游戏机器人开发,机器人可以实时分析游戏环境,做出最优的移动和攻击决策,在《英雄联盟》中,机器人可以利用哈希算法快速定位敌方目标,并规划出最优的攻击路径。

  2. 服务机器人
    服务机器人在游戏中的应用也非常广泛,在《Apex英雄》中,服务机器人可以利用哈希算法快速响应玩家的指令,提供高效的技能使用和资源管理,这种机器人不仅提升了游戏的体验,还为玩家提供了更智能的服务。

  3. 救援机器人
    在某些游戏类型中,机器人需要具备救援功能,通过哈希游戏机器人开发,救援机器人可以快速定位目标位置,并规划出最优的救援路径,这种机器人在游戏中的应用不仅提升了游戏的可玩性,还为玩家提供了更多的游戏乐趣。

  4. 智能机器人
    智能机器人是哈希游戏机器人开发的另一个重要应用场景,通过结合哈希算法和机器学习技术,机器人可以具备更强的自主学习和适应能力,在《机器人战争》中,机器人可以利用哈希算法快速分析对手的策略,并调整自己的行为以取得胜利。


哈希游戏机器人开发的未来趋势

随着人工智能技术的不断发展,哈希游戏机器人开发也在不断进步,哈希游戏机器人开发可能会朝着以下几个方向发展:

  1. 人工智能的深度结合
    哈希游戏机器人开发可能会更加注重人工智能技术的深度结合,利用深度学习技术优化哈希算法的性能,或者通过强化学习技术提升机器人的自主决策能力。

  2. 多机器人协作
    多机器人协作是游戏开发中的一个重要趋势,哈希游戏机器人开发可能会更加注重多机器人协作的实现,例如让多个机器人共同完成一个任务,或者让机器人之间进行高效的通信和协作。

  3. 跨平台兼容性
    随着游戏的跨平台化发展,哈希游戏机器人开发也需要考虑跨平台兼容性,哈希算法可能会更加注重在不同平台上实现高效的运行,以满足更多玩家的需求。

  4. 边缘计算的应用
    边缘计算是现代计算技术的重要方向,哈希游戏机器人开发可能会更加注重边缘计算的应用,例如在机器人本地进行数据处理和决策,从而减少对云端资源的依赖。

哈希游戏机器人开发,从技术到应用的探索哈希游戏机器人开发,

发表评论